    Ventures are used to send your retainer on errands as it were. There is a quest to unlock the ability to send them. When you unlock it they start out as lv1 and you can select any class you have unlocked. Their max class level is equal to your level in that class. So if you aren't 50 in it they won't hit 50. On top of that you can equip them gear you have on yourself. So you can free up space. Once you have a class selected you'll be able to send them on errands. It will depend on if you made them a combat class or a gathering classes. They get different pools. The errands are the same though. There are 3 errands or expeditions you can send them on. Only two will be available from the start and then you can unlock the other as they level up. The first one is a hour expedition where they will go out and get what you tell them. There is a list of items you can select from based on their level, so lv1 it'll be one item, but increase as they level up. Every 5 levels a new rank unlocks with that. The second expedition is a 18 hour one, but you don't get to pick what they bring back it is just random based on the rank you select. The last one unlocks at 15 and is a Quick Expedition that last for an hour as well, but is random.

    The difference here is the one hour specific only consumes 1 venture and you know exactly what you're getting, though it'll be NQ or HQ items. The 18 hour is random and has a small loot pool it grabs from based on the rank. The Quick has no level requirements, but is highly random and has a very massive loot pool. The Quick literally can bring you a Primal Weapon, a part to a house or a slice of meat, it is that random and vast. So Quick is very ideal for the wide range of items it can bring you and potential. But the good items have a low odds.

    Certain ranks do require certain item level. The highest requires il80. The gathering requires gathering stats, the high being like 370 I think.

    Yeah, the game opens up a ton when you hit 50. It is in way, when the game truly begins. A significant amount of content sits behind that level 50 wall. The EX fights are even harder versions of the hard mode to put simply. They have new mechanics, stronger attacks, more HP and in general play very differently from the previous version while still having some similarities. They'll feel familiar, but you'll quickly see that's all it is familiar. They'll be totally new fights. Titan EX is still the stop gap for many people.

    Coil unlocks after you complete all of the original Hard Mode Primals, Ifrit, Garuda and Titan. There is a quest that becomes available to unlock Coil at that point. Just do that and it is open for you to do.

    It is surprising to see people just handing out gil. But he could be referring to getting crafted gear to tide you over until you get full myth/coil/soldiery gear. The more wealthy players will craft or buy the il70 gear and meld materia on to them. It will make them comparable to the myth gear. So some will do that until they have the myth to afford the rest. But yeah, gil will likely not be used to upgrade your jobs, but your crafting and gathering.
